Description
Begin your tour in Sulphur Bay and learn how the Māori knew about the special qualities of these waters for centuries and how in the 19th century Pākehā (non-Māori) traveled from around the country to sit in hot pools and springs because of their healing powers. Continue around the lakefront and walk through the Government Gardens to learn about the construction of various bathhouses over 100 years or so to be the South Seas version of a European-style spa. Using historic photographs your guide will bring to life the risks and unusual treatments undertaken by patients keen to ‘take the cure’ in Rotorua. Listen to your guide as they tell you about interesting historical figures, the geothermal activity and how it works, what exactly the scary-looking therapies and treatments given to patients were, and about the flora and fauna of the area. At the end of your walk, have the option of continuing to the new luxury Wai Ariki Hot Springs & Spa on the lakefront where there is a cafe. The shorter version of the walk is a circular walk, returning to the starting point.Includes
